首页 > 科技 >

一元多项式的相加数据结构链表实现_一元多项式链表相加 📊💻

发布时间:2025-02-26 11:43:35来源:

一元多项式的运算在计算机科学中有着广泛的应用,特别是在算法设计和数值计算领域。今天,我们将探讨如何使用链表数据结构来实现一元多项式的相加。📊

首先,我们需要了解一元多项式的表示方式。在数学中,一个一元多项式可以被看作是形如a0 + a1x + a2x² + ... + anxn的表达式,其中a0, a1, ..., an是系数,而x是变量。在链表实现中,每个节点存储一个系数和一个指数,通过指针链接起来形成链表。📝

接下来,我们讨论如何实现两个多项式的相加。主要步骤包括遍历两个链表,比较指数大小,相同指数的项合并,不同指数的项直接连接到结果链表中。这一过程需要细心处理,以确保最终结果的准确性。🔍

最后,为了验证我们的实现,我们可以编写一些测试用例,比如相加简单的一元多项式以及复杂的情况。通过这些测试,我们可以确保代码的正确性和鲁棒性。🚀

通过以上步骤,我们可以看到利用链表实现一元多项式的相加不仅是一个有趣的编程挑战,也是一个加深对数据结构理解的好机会。希望大家能够动手实践,体验编程的乐趣!🎉

编程 数据结构 链表

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。